Decoding the Ford Aod Wiring Diagram What It Is and Why It Matters
At its core, a Ford Aod Wiring Diagram is a schematic that visually represents all the electrical connections within the AOD transmission and its related systems. Think of it as a roadmap for electricity. It shows where each wire originates, where it goes, and what component it controls. This includes everything from the neutral safety switch, which prevents the engine from starting in gear, to the kick-down or throttle valve linkage sensor, which helps the transmission decide when to downshift for acceleration. The importance of having the correct Ford Aod Wiring Diagram cannot be overstated; it is the key to diagnosing electrical faults and ensuring proper transmission function.
These diagrams are invaluable tools for a variety of tasks. For instance, if your AOD isn't shifting correctly, the wiring diagram allows you to trace the signals from the various sensors and solenoids to identify any breaks in the circuit, faulty connections, or malfunctioning components. They are also indispensable when installing aftermarket performance parts, such as a shift kit or a standalone transmission controller. Understanding the existing wiring allows for seamless integration of new components without accidentally interrupting critical functions. Here are some common uses:
- Troubleshooting no-shift conditions
- Diagnosing erratic shifting
- Installing overdrive lockup controllers
- Modifying gear ratios
- Checking neutral safety switch operation
